 * I have a very long table (±950 records)in which I need to enter images. As I 
   need to click the ‘insert image’ every time I move to another record, I spend
   a lot of time scrolling! Is there a way to filter the table rows in the admin,
   so that I can insert images in smaller batches, with less scrolling?

 * I’m really sorry, but unfortunately, it is not possible to filter the table on
   the “Edit” screen. I do have some ideas to make this possible, but that will 
   still take some time for development. Sorry. 🙁
 * Meanwhile, maybe the browser’s search function can help you navigate on the page
   more quickly? If you use the “Ctrl+F” shortcut that most browsers use, that should
   help.

 * I am now trying to work with sorting the image column by content, empty fields
   first. Every now and then saving will re-sort the records and bring up the records
   that still need edited close to the table manipulation screen. Not optimal, but
   better!
